Wouldn't it be better if you only ignored the 'illegal seek' error
instead of ignoring any ioerror (should it even be always discarded) ? I
get a 'bad file descriptor' under Windows 7, but, again, can it be
always discarded ? 

You can also reproduce the problem without using wave:

>>> import sys
>>> sys.stdout.tell()

I'm really unsure about the proposed patch.
